SUBPRIME MARKET CRIME

A Poem by Bill Grimes Jr.

Babylon crumbles

Wall Street limps along

Goldman Sachs commissions

Subprime market crime

A billion pensions lost

Such a lofty cost

Unbridled excess

Liberty undressed

Overvalued housing

First time mortgage dreams

Raped by Ponzi Schemes

Completely void of logic

So it seems

Morgan Stanley bullshit

Citi Bank’s raw greed

The monkey on our back

A travesty indeed

Joe Citizen is drowning

Nursing ancient rage

Narcissistic daze

Duped

Out of the hallowed nest egg

Our self made flood is rising

American Dream

Is slowly dying

Rest in peace

Sacred 401K

A noble vision shattered

Is there shame in strategic default?

Almighty Spike TV

Sixteen commercial barrage

Yes

I said sixteen

Every 15 minutes it seems

Now that’s entertainment

So many elephants

Stampede our tiny room

Gigantic pile of doom

Such is our predicament

As despondency flows forth

Following its own due course……..
